During my recent visit to Kerala, I decided to spend a few days at Aanandakosha Ayurveda Retreat in Kovalam near Trivandrum. I was searching for a peaceful place where I could relax, reduce stress, and experience authentic Ayurveda treatment. What I found there was much more than a wellness holiday it became a deeply personal and healing experience for both my body and mind.
Before booking, I was a little worried because the retreat normally does not allow children. Since I was travelling with my family, I explained my situation to the management. To my surprise, they kindly approved my special request. From the beginning, their understanding and warmth made me feel comfortable. When we arrived, Managing Director Elisabeth personally welcomed us with such kindness that it immediately felt less like a hotel and more like visiting caring friends.
The retreat itself is located in a calm and peaceful area close to Kovalam Beach and very near Trivandrum International Airport. After a long journey, reaching the retreat was easy and convenient. The peaceful atmosphere was the first thing I noticed. Surrounded by greenery and silence, it felt completely different from busy city life.
Our room was simple, spacious, and very clean. It had good air-conditioning and a lovely balcony where I enjoyed sitting quietly in the evenings. One thing I noticed immediately was that there was no television in the room. At first, I thought it might feel strange, but after a day or two I actually appreciated it. Without television and constant noise, I felt more relaxed and mentally peaceful. It helped me disconnect from daily stress and focus completely on rest and healing.
Soon after arrival, the reception team arranged my consultation with Dr. Manesh, the resident Ayurvedic doctor. He was available throughout my stay whenever I needed advice or had questions. What impressed me most was the way he approached the consultation. He did not simply ask about physical pain or symptoms. Instead, he spent time understanding my lifestyle, eating habits, stress levels, sleep patterns, and overall health condition. I felt he genuinely wanted to understand me as a person before recommending treatment.
After the consultation, Dr. Manesh suggested a five-day rejuvenation therapy program specially designed for my needs. Every day I received two treatment sessions. Each therapy used traditional Ayurvedic oils and techniques that helped my body relax deeply. From the very first treatment, I could feel stress slowly leaving my body. By the third day, I was sleeping better, feeling lighter, and emotionally calmer.
The therapists were professional, gentle, and caring. Every session felt peaceful and unhurried. Unlike luxury spas that focus mainly on beauty or comfort, the treatments here felt truly therapeutic and authentic. I understood why Ayurveda is considered a complete healing system in Kerala.
One of the best parts of my stay was that I could fully enjoy the treatments without worrying about my children. The retreat has a swimming pool, and while I attended therapy sessions, my children happily spent time swimming with their father. Seeing them enjoy themselves allowed me to relax mentally as well. Usually, mothers cannot fully disconnect during holidays, but here I finally had moments where I could truly rest.
Another unforgettable part of the experience was the food. Honestly, I cannot describe it as typical Indian food or European cuisine. It was something completely different — healthy Ayurvedic food prepared with great care. Every meal felt light, nourishing, and balanced. Curious about the menu, I asked the kitchen staff about it, and they explained that many dishes were personally designed by Dr. Manesh according to Ayurvedic principles.
